Is it possible to purchase Microsoft Office Business
Contact Manager separately as a stand alone? Does
Microsoft Outlook 2003 come as a stand alone product or
upgrade with business contacts manager or do you have to
purchase the Small Business Edition 2003 in order to get
it?
- Does it work over a Wide Area Network (ie between
several offices)
- What would the cost be to run it across 18
workstations, necessitating 18 licenses.
- If we expanded to more than 25 people, would this
product still be useful to us?
Regards,
Robert Walker.
 
Outlook 2003 is available as a standalone product, but BCM is available only as part of the Professional or Small Business Editioin suites.

Since BCM is a single-user product with no sharing capability, your question about WAN usage is somewhat moot.
